Dyson V12 Detect Slim
The Dyson V12 Detect Slim is light and nimble, making it easy to maneuver. Its suction power rivals more expensive models and it includes high-tech features like laser headlights for detecting dust and an LCD screen showing battery life. However, its small 12-ounce dustbin requires frequent emptying, and it doesn’t stand on its own. Despite these flaws, Dyson covers this model with a two-year warranty, and its replaceable battery is a significant advantage.
Shark PowerDetect Clean & Empty Cordless Vacuum
This model performs well, comparable to the Dyson V12, with the added benefit of a self-emptying dock that minimizes maintenance. It copes well with various debris but struggles with pet fur. The Shark PowerDetect has a small dustbin that can be offset by using the additional dock. It is louder than other vacuums but has a five-year warranty, the longest among these picks.
Tineco GO Pet Cordless Vacuum
As a budget option, the Tineco GO Pet comes with a large dustbin and several useful tools. It excels at picking up large and fine debris efficiently, though it occasionally struggles on lightweight rugs. Its 38-minute runtime and replaceable battery make it a practical choice, though it may be harder to find replacement batteries.
Best for Heavier Use
Ryobi 18V One+ HP Advanced Stick Vacuum Kit
This vacuum is a sturdy, versatile option with excellent suction power and multiple attachments. While heavier than other models, it quickly stands on its own and recharges in just two hours. The Ryobi’s large dustbin is suitable for handling substantial debris and pet fur, and its battery is compatible with other Ryobi tools.
How We Picked and Tested
We have tested over 100 models in recent years, focusing on suction, airflow, convenience, and durability. We measured each vacuum’s ability to handle various types of debris on different surfaces. Many models were tested for comfort, sound level, and ease of use. Opting for vacuums with replaceable batteries and good warranties was crucial, as these factors contribute significantly to their longevity.
